Boot Mobility Scooter

If you are unable to walk, a boot scooter could be a good option. They are simple to carry out and into the car and can be used on pavements.

Boot scooters are available both four- and three-wheeled versions. There are also foldable versions.

Easy to dismantle

A boot mobility scooter is a class 2 scooter that folds or dismantled in order to fit into the trunk of your car. These are very popular, and can be dismantled in seconds. They are ideal for those who are unable to walk.

These scooters can be made of aluminum and are generally light. This makes them easy to take apart. To dismantle a mobility scooter, simply remove the seat and battery pack then split the chassis of the scooter into two pieces.

You will need to be extremely cautious while doing this because the scooter is extremely heavy. This is an intimidating task and you must follow the manufacturer's instructions to ensure that you're doing it safely. Once you've separated your scooter, put it back in your boot as quickly as you can to prevent becoming damaged.

After you've stuffed your scooter into your car, make sure it's in the correct position to avoid damaging your car or scratching your paintwork. Start by placing the rear section first followed by the front section and then the seat and battery pack.

Easy to store

If you're keeping your scooter in your garage or car boot, there are a few simple steps to follow that will ensure your mobility aid stays in top shape. First, ensure that your battery pack has been recharged. Batteries will begin to lose power if you don't charge them. Be sure to keep your scooter in a dry area that won't rust and be careful not to keep it under too much stress.

Another important aspect of keeping your mobility scooter is to keep the controls clean and dry. After every use, wipe off the controls to avoid the build-up of dirt. This will ensure that your scooter is running smoothly and will make it last longer.

To take your scooter apart, it's easy to do with the majority of the latest models being simple and quick to take off. Most of them have a lever that lifts your scooter up between the front and rear parts so you can easily access the battery pack.

It's a good idea to put a blanket over the frame after you have removed the battery pack, to shield it from paintwork scratches and scratches. This will ensure that your scooter is in good condition. Next you will need to take the heaviest section of the scooter, and then place it inside your boot. Once everything is in place it is time to begin reassembling the scooter.

If you're uncertain about how to dismantle your bike, it's always a good idea to read the owners manual. The manual should have plenty of photos that show how to safely and correctly dismantle your scooter.

Having the ability to dismantle your scooter into five or four pieces makes it a lot easier to put in your vehicle's boot. After folding it, put the rear section first, followed by the front portion, and then the basket and battery pack.

If you're looking for a vehicle that can be used frequently and is meant to replace your vehicle, then you'll want to look into purchasing a Class 3 mobility scooter. These scooters can be used on roads, but they must be equipped with all-inclusive lighting and indicators.

Based on the model They can travel at up to 8mph and offer better ride quality than their smaller Class 2 counterparts. They're also more comfortable and durable, with adjustable seats that recline and slide. Some are equipped with brakes that regeneratively work, and they can be folded and stored in the back of your car when not in use.
